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
263179832 04205674501 748457
3865991877 52470 712719247
3865991877 52470 712719247
51 41 328
All about undefined
Interested in learning more?
3865991877 52470 712719247
51 41 328
See more
15 46879235 9131
850041 2911 929035531
See more
926 191269
03134833468 4264561 75099911200 351
See more